Tap water in major cities and tourist hotspots like Paris, Lyon, Nice, Marseille, and Bordeaux meets or exceeds international standards for drinking water quality. It's thoroughly tested and treated to remove contaminants, making it reliably safe for consumption.What is the UK ranked in tap water?
In fact, according to Drinking Water Inspectorate, UK compliance with water safety parameters has consistently been above 99.9% over the past few years. This has resulted in a strong international reputation. In the 2021 Environmental Performance Index (EPI), the UK ranked 4th overall for water and sanitation.Where in Spain can you not drink tap water?

The overall answer to can you drink tap water in Portugal is yes. In most regions, including urban areas like Lisbon and Porto, tap water is considered safe to drink. Portugal water quality is closely monitored and regulated to comply with European Union (EU) standards, which are some of the strictest in the world.Can you drink tap water in Germany?
As a rule, the quality of tap water in Germany conforms to strict regulations, is checked very thoroughly, and is perfectly drinkable without any treatment. In fact, its quality is comparable to most commercially available drinking waters in many places.Can I drink the tap water in Cyprus?
The safety of food and drinking water quality in Cyprus is monitored by the Health Inspectors of the Medical and Public Health Services of the Ministry of Health and the Local Authorities. Food and drinking water are of high quality, absolutely safe and no food or water-borne diseases occur.Can you drink Italian tap water?
The Italian Ministry of Health rigorously monitors water quality, ensuring it is safe from contaminants such as bacteria, parasites, heavy metals, and chemical pollutants. In major cities such as Rome, Milan, Florence, Naples, and Venice, tap water is consistently safe and often praised for its good quality and taste.Can you drink tap water in Australia?
